Mission
In Psalm 24:1 the Bible proclaims that, "The earth is the Lord's and everything in it". That's right, it all belongs to our Creator, even the Kentucky deer herd. Our charge is to take care of His creation and manage it well and for His children and especially the less fortunate. Through the Sportsman's Challenge you have an opportunity to make and impact by providing food for the hungry. Every deer harvested and donated to KHFH provides 440 meals for the hungry. Imagine the impact you can make if you harvest just one deer, what about two, three or more. We have a great resource to feed the hungry and KHFH is a great organization dedicated to the task. The goal of the Sportsman's Challenge is to to feed the hungry and develop a closer connection to our Creator and our fellow hunters. So come join in and, " Hunt to Make a Difference, Feed the Hungry".

How the Sportsmans Challenge works
Step 1: Register….. go to Registration Tab on this site and print out the registration card complete it and mail to address indicated.
Step 2: GO HUNTING!
Step 3: YOU MUST turn your deer in to one of the designated KHFH processors. For a list of KHFH Processors and rules, CLICK HERE.
When you turn your deer in you must request from the processor a KHFH donation receipt. Complete the receipt and include your confirmation number. The processor will keep the receipt and give you a copy. This receipt must be mailed to us at the address indicated under official rules.
The receipt from the processor must be marked "Sportsmans Challenge" and the copy the processor keeps and the one you mail to us must have "Sportsman's Challenge" written on the donation receipt.
If you donate a deer a KHFH processor not designated in the list above it is your responsibility to make sure the processor will accept your donation. All KHFH processors have a quota and when the quota is met they will no longer accept donations to KHFH or Sportsman's Challenge.
*NOTE: During the busy times of hunting season some processors may reach capacity and be unable to accept deer donations.
Step 4: For each donation you make you will get your name in a drawing to be held January 27, 2009 at the Southeast Christian Church Wild Game Feed.
